## Load Testing the Checkout Flow

Before publishing your plugin to the Cartwheel Marketplace, run the full load suite against the staging checkout at Merrowtide Commerce. Ramp from 50 to 800 virtual shoppers over ten minutes, watching p95 latency on the payment step. Plugins that add synchronous hooks must stay under 120ms overhead. Once the suite passes, sign your bundle with the key below.

rollout seal: bky4_x7Gc

Handover: Brix to Alden. Fixed the N+1 in the Quillgate GraphQL layer — resolver batching via the new loader pool, so plugin authors no longer trigger per-node fetches on nested collections. If your plugin overrides the resolver chain, switch to batchResolve or you'll reintroduce the problem. Batch sizes and loader timeouts are tunable per environment. The current production settings for the Quillgate service are as follows.

config for kagup-hahig:
druwyn:
  pin: 2801
  metrics_host: metrics.druwyn.zemvarlabs.internal
  tenant: sorius
  seal: seal_798a43d7

Handover — Vexler partner SFTP drop

Ownership moves to you today. Drop runs hourly from Vexler's end into the intake bucket via the relay host. Watch for zero-byte files; their exporter flakes on Mondays. Creds live in the ops vault, path noted in the runbook. Vault auto-seals after 48h idle. Support escalations go to the on-call rotation, not me. If the vault is sealed when you need it, unseal with the recovery passphrase below.

recovery phrase for tadug-fafof: zorwyn-kasion

Team —

DR drill for the Skyhollow weather-alert fan-out runs Thursday. We will sever the primary broker in the Dunmere region and verify alerts re-route within 90 seconds. New folks: watch the fan-out dashboard, note any dropped subscriber groups, and log timings in the drill doc. Do not page anyone; this is simulated. To unseal the standby broker during the drill, use the passphrase below.

unlock words, kagef-taduf: fenir-quenix-norwyn-sorvan-gormir-gorir-fraok